The trap every owner is in

The work that pays you takes all day. The work that feeds next month never gets done.

Posting. Your Google profile. Answering reviews. It has to happen every week, and it's the first thing that gets dropped. Here's what the platforms do with that.

Social

5

× the engagement

Most owners manage fewer than one post a week. Sporadic posting is invisible. Businesses that post consistently for 20+ weeks see around five times the engagement. The algorithms reward showing up.

Buffer · study of 100k+ accounts

Google

7

× more clicks

A Business Profile you set up once and left alone quietly slides down "near me" results. Unanswered reviews, no updates. Google reads that as a business going quiet and hands the search to whoever looks alive. Complete, actively managed profiles get up to seven times more clicks.
